Janet Jackson, born on May 16, 1966, into the famous Jackson family, experienced a life marked by both immense fame and personal challenges. She rose to stardom in the 1980s and 1990s, known for her innovative music and choreography, as well as her landmark albums like "Control" and "Rhythm Nation." Despite her success, she faced struggles with public scrutiny, family dynamics, and personal relationships. Throughout her career, Jackson has remained a powerful figure in the music industry, advocating for social issues and women's rights.
